Maze Solver

The visuals below showcase the assembly of the robot utilizing 3D-printed adapters, which were crafted in SolidWorks, to integrate the Tetrix Robotics kit for the chassis, the LEGO Mindstorms EV3 kit for the rotating arm and various adapters, and linear rails. Additionally, I developed an algorithm that effectively navigated various mazes using RobotC and C++.
